Current public status
As of April 24, 2026, no official public DeepSeek-V4 GitHub repository was visible on the official deepseek-ai organization page.

Confirm whether a repository is actually public before you trust any reposted screenshots or cloned mirrors.
Review V3, R1, and V3.2-Exp to understand what is already public and how the naming is currently presented.
If a page says “official DeepSeek V4 GitHub” but cannot link to the official org, it is not a reliable source.
